[发明专利]区块校验方法和区块链系统有效
申请号: | 202110632083.6 | 申请日: | 2021-06-07 |
公开(公告)号: | CN113543073B | 公开(公告)日: | 2023-05-09 |
发明(设计)人: | 马书惠;田新雪 | 申请(专利权)人: | 中国联合网络通信集团有限公司 |
主分类号: | H04W4/44 | 分类号: | H04W4/44;H04W4/46;H04W12/00;H04L67/12;H04L67/10;H04L67/568 |
代理公司: | 北京天昊联合知识产权代理有限公司 11112 | 代理人: | 彭瑞欣;冯建基 |
地址: | 100033 ***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 区块 校验 方法 系统 | ||
本发明公开了一种区块校验方法和区块链系统。该方法包括:领导基站获取所属区块链网络中的车辆终端之间的边缘缓存交易,并基于该边缘缓存交易生成待校验区块;领导基站将待校验区块广播至区块链网络中,以供各校验基站对待校验区块进行校验,领导基站获取全部校验基站生成的校验结果,并在超过第一预设数量的校验结果均为校验通过的情况下,将待校验区块加入到区块链中。本发明能够提高区块校验效率、降低区块校验能耗。
技术领域
本发明涉及通信技术领域,具体涉及区块校验方法和区块链系统。
背景技术
车联网环境下,车辆收集车载传感器产生的数据,包括感知的道路和周边环境信息、车辆自身状况信息以及车载应用程序所存储的娱乐资讯等信息。车辆具有一定的缓存,可以将以上数据存储在车辆本地服务器。
但是,由于车辆的存储资源有限,当资源受限的车辆不能将其收集的数据存储在本地服务器时,任何一辆有空闲缓存资源的车都可充当缓存资源提供者,并为资源受限的车辆提供边缘缓存服务。车辆间可以互相借用缓存资源,形成一种交易,进一步使用区块链的区块校验方法来保证交易的安全性。传统的区块校验方法通常采用工作量证明(PoW)的方式,但是其对于车联网的低能耗、低时延要求不能满足。
发明内容
为此,本发明提供一种区块校验方法和区块链系统,旨在能够满足车联网的低时延、低能耗的要求,提高用户体验。
为了实现上述目的,本发明第一方面提供一种区块校验方法,该方法应用于区块链系统,所述区块链系统包括中心节点、多个车辆终端和多个基站,多个基站中部分基站包括预先确定的一个领导基站和多个校验基站,所述方法包括:
领导基站获取所属区块链网络中的车辆终端之间的边缘缓存交易,并基于所述边缘缓存交易生成待校验区块;
所述领导基站将所述待校验区块广播至所述区块链网络中,以供各所述校验基站对所述待校验区块进行校验;
所述领导基站获取全部所述校验基站生成的校验结果,并在超过第一预设数量的校验结果均为校验通过的情况下,将所述待校验区块加入到区块链中。
可选地,各所述校验基站对所述待校验区块进行校验,包括:
针对每个所述校验基站,该校验基站识别所述待校验区块中包含的边缘缓存交易的合法性,生成识别结果;
该校验基站接收其他校验基站发送的识别结果,并基于其他校验基站发送的识别结果和自身生成的识别结果生成校验结果;
该校验基站将所述校验结果发送至所述领导基站。
可选地,该校验基站识别所述待校验区块中包含的边缘缓存交易的合法性,生成识别结果,包括:
该校验基站若识别出所述待校验区块中包含的边缘缓存交易为合法交易,则生成校验通过的识别结果;
该校验基站若识别出所述待校验区块中包含的边缘缓存交易为非合法交易,则生成校验不通过的识别结果。
可选地,该校验基站接收其他校验基站发送的识别结果,并基于其他校验基站发送的识别结果和自身生成的识别结果生成校验结果,包括:
该校验基站判断所有校验基站对应的识别结果中校验通过的识别结果的数量是否超过第二预设数量;
该校验基站在判断出所有校验基站对应的识别结果中校验通过的识别结果的数量超过第二预设数量的情况下,根据校验通过的识别结果生成所述校验结果;
该校验基站在判断出所有校验基站对应的识别结果中校验通过的识别结果的数量不超过第二预设数量的情况下,根据校验不通过的识别结果生成所述校验结果。
可选地,所述领导基站获取所属区块链网络中的车辆终端之间的边缘缓存交易之前,还包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国联合网络通信集团有限公司,未经中国联合网络通信集团有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110632083.6/2.html,转载请声明来源钻瓜专利网。